    I've just submitted v3.1.1 of VAT4EU for the Zen Cart moderators' review; I'll post back here when it's available for download.

    This release contains changes associated with the following GitHub issues:

    #16: Correcting integration with Edit Orders, v4.6.0+.
    #17: Use zen_cfg_read_only to ensure that the version number is read-only.
    #18: Correct strict comparison that resulted in incorrect message to customer.

    Good day,

    Sorry (if I do understand sometyhng wrong or issue has been already described), but the following code in auto.vat_for_eu_countries.php module can cause "Undefined variable" warning:

    Code:
                // -----
                // Issued during the create-account, address-book or checkout-new-address processing, indicates that an address record
                // has been created/updated and gives us a chance to record the customer's VAT Number.
                //
                // Entry:
                //  $p1 ... An associative array that contains the address-book entry's default data.
                //
                case 'NOTIFY_MODULE_CREATE_ACCOUNT_ADDED_ADDRESS_BOOK_RECORD':  //- Fall through ...
                case 'NOTIFY_MODULE_CHECKOUT_ADDED_ADDRESS_BOOK_RECORD':        //- Fall through ...
                case 'NOTIFY_MODULE_ADDRESS_BOOK_UPDATED_ADDRESS_BOOK_RECORD':  //- Fall through ...
                case 'NOTIFY_MODULE_ADDRESS_BOOK_ADDED_ADDRESS_BOOK_RECORD':
                    $address_book_id = ($eventID === 'NOTIFY_MODULE_ADDRESS_BOOK_UPDATED_ADDRESS_BOOK_RECORD') ? $p1['address_book_id'] : $p1['address_id'];
                    $vat_number = zen_db_prepare_input($_POST['vat_number']);
                    $db->Execute(
                        "UPDATE " . TABLE_ADDRESS_BOOK . "
                            SET entry_vat_number = '$vat_number',
                                entry_vat_validated = " . $this->vatNumberStatus . "
                          WHERE address_book_id = $address_book_id
                            AND customers_id = " . (int)$_SESSION['customer_id'] . "
                          LIMIT 1"
                    );
                    break;
    $_SESSION['customer_id'] is not yet defined in case of "NOTIFY_MODULE_CREATE_ACCOUNT_ADDED_ADDRESS_BOOK_RECORD"

    My humble suggestion is to use something like this instead:

    (int)($eventID === 'NOTIFY_MODULE_CREATE_ACCOUNT_ADDED_ADDRESS_BOOK_RECORD' ? $p1[0]['value'] : $_SESSION['customer_id'])

    v3.2.0 of the VAT for EU Countries is now available for download: https://www.zen-cart.com/downloads.php?do=file&id=2164

    This release represents a massive restructuring, with support for


    • Zen Cart versions 1.5.8a and 2.0.0
    • PHP versions 8.0 through 8.3.
    • Edit Orders, v4.7.0 and later
    • One-Page Checkout, v2.4.6 and later
    • Bootstrap template, v3.6.3 and later

    OK, let's try to figure out where the installation failed. You'll need to use phpMyAdmin to check the following database tables.

    1. configuration_group. Should have a record with a configuration_group_title of VAT4EU Plugin.
    2. configuration. There should be 9 records with a configuration_key LIKE VAT4EU%.
    3. admin_pages. Should have a record with a page_key of configVat4Eu.
    4. address_book. Should have two new fields named entry_vat_number and entry_vat_validated.
    5. orders. Should have two new fields named billing_vat_number and billing_vat_validated.

    If you could perform the above database checks to see where the installation stopped, I can suggest what step to take next.
